Return To ShopThe Fontainemelon 762 is a manual wind watch movement that features sweep seconds, a date function that can be set by +/-24h, a sweep seconds hand, and a calendar. It was commonly used around the 1960s. The specific differences between the Fontainemelon 762 and the Felsa 4013 are not known.
